§ 55.102. APPLICABILITY. (a) This subchapter applies
only to the provision of caller identification service.
(b) This subchapter does not apply to:
(1) an identification service that is used in a
limited system, including a central office based PBX-type system;
(2) information that is used on a public agency's
emergency telephone line or on a line that receives the primary
emergency telephone number (911);
(3) information exchanged between telecommunications
utilities, enhanced service providers, or other entities that is
necessary for the setting up, processing, transmission, or billing
of telecommunications or related services;
(4) information provided in compliance with
applicable law or legal process; or
(5) an identification service provided in connection
with a 700, 800, or 900 access code telecommunications service.
Acts 1997, 75th Leg., ch. 166, § 1, eff. Sept. 1, 1997.
